#e6860d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e6860d is composed of 90.2% red, 52.5%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 41.7% magenta, 94.3%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 33.5 degrees, a saturation of 89.3% and a lightness of 47.6%. #e6860d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ff1a with #cd0d00. Closest websafe color is: #ff9900.

Shades and Tints of #e6860d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070400 is the darkest color, while #fefaf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e6860d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f7a74 is the less saturated color, while #ef8704 is the most saturated one.
